NOTICE is hereby given that Property -tax under :l The Property-tax Act, 1880," for the year cominen-ing on the Ist day of April, 1880, will be payable as follows : — In respect of the duty cf tbirtfen-sixteenths of a penny, where the amount 1 be under fifteen pound?, the same s all be paid on tho fourteenth day of December, on* thousand eight hundred and eigh'y-six ; and where such duty amounts to fifteen pouocb, or exceds that Bum, the pame phall be paid in two equal instalments, the first of such instalments being payable on the said fourteenth day of December, and the eerondof such instalments on the eigh-h day of February, one thousand eight hundred and eighty-seven. 1 And notice is hereby further given that the places where the eaid tas eha'l be paid shall be any post office which is also a money order office, and at the office of the Property-tas : Com uiissi oner, at the Government Bailaings, Wellington. 1 J. SPEBRY, no3o Property-tax Commissioner. . SOUTHLAND BUILDING AND INVESTMENT SOCIETY AND BANK OF DEPOSIT. I Established on the Mutual Principle, bor- » rowers and investors alike participating in the profits. £25 shares mature in 7, 9, or 11 years, ao 5 cording to the fortnightly or monthly payments 3 New shares issued on the first pay days in Feblttjcy, May, August, and November. The highest current rate of interest allowed for deposits. Money left at call is credited with interest for each day it remains with the Society.
